2182. Verse 8 And he took butter and milk, and the young bull* which he made ready, and set it before them. And he stood before them under the tree, and they ate.
'He took butter and milk, and the young bull which he made ready' means all those things thus joined together, 'butter' being the celestial part of the rational, 'milk' the spiritual deriving from this, 'young bull' the corresponding natural part. 'And set it before them' means that He so prepared Himself to receive. 'And he stood before them under the tree' means consequent perception, 'tree', as previously, being perception. 'And they ate' means communication in this manner. * lit. the son of an ox
